Transaction 120fd45c72e15b95f20b56133eb5a07fdeb39f77fe3b7cd553ca03efec60e23b

1 Input
2 Outputs
  • 120fd45c72e15b95f20b56133eb5a07fdeb39f77fe3b7cd553ca03efec60e23b:0
  • value  1667700
    address  15ZUU3e7BBRDWsbwZmBw4ZTLPwAbVXELLv
  • 120fd45c72e15b95f20b56133eb5a07fdeb39f77fe3b7cd553ca03efec60e23b:1
  • value  327339691
    address  13X4dNMgjDHfzbBNVp9h2DMqAPd3PW7Srg